New Assembly and Breaking Changes
While working on this release, I was doing too much copy and paste, which I hate. If you find yourself doing that in your projects, then it’s time to break them out into a new reusable assembly. So I had to move some classes to a new assembly that can be used by all the other assemblies.
The new assembly is called dotNetTips.Utility.Standard.Common. The classes that I move are:
- LoggingHelper
- ArgumentInvalidException
- ArgumentReadOnlyException
- DirectoryNotFoundException
- LoggableException
- MessageNotQueuedException
If you using any of these types, please make sure to add this new NuGet package to your project.
